TobyMac, Crowder & Switchfoot to Perform at K-LOVE

K-LOVE

TobyMac, Switchfoot,Crowder, Lauren Daigle, Matthew West, Danny Gokey, Natalie Grant, Sidewalk Prophets and Unspoken have just been announced as the final group of performers for this year’s K-LOVE Fan Awards. Among the performers for this year’s show, a surprise artist will take part in the live show at the Grand Ole Opry. Hillsong UNITED’s Joel Houston and Dylan Thomas, Kari Jobe, Jeremy Camp, Plumb, University of Miami Head Football Coach Mark Richt, Phil Wickham, Author Jan Harrison, Tenth Avenue North’s Mike Donehey and more will join other top industry names as presenters.

Fan voting is still ongoing for this year’s show which will be co-hosted by Elisabeth Hasselbeck and Matthew West live from the Grand Ole Opry House on June 5, 2016. The event will be heard live across the country on the K-LOVE Radio Network and around the world on KLOVE.com. With 531 total signals in 48 states, K-LOVE Radio is enjoyed by millions of people across the country in markets including New York City, Chicago, Nashville, Philadelphia, Miami, Denver and many more. Amongst the packed schedule at The K-LOVE Fan Awards Ultimate Fan Experience Weekend (June 3 and 4), The Run For Love 5K (June 4), uniting fans and artists to raise funds to provide family-style, residential care and sustainable solutions that fight against Haiti’s orphan crisis through Hands & Feet Project.
